New Meadow Farm

Cultivating Sustainability with Solar Power

Paul McConkey is the proud owner of New Meadow Farm, a long-standing egg farm in Towerhill, New Brunswick, with a rich 5th generation history. In a significant move towards sustainability, the family recently introduced a 20kw NOREASTER solar farm on their property, opting for the user-friendly In-A-Box system, installed by the family themselves. This pilot program represents a first step towards a greener future, as the McConkey family intends to expand their solar efforts in the future, both for the benefit of upcoming generations and to contribute positively to the environment.


Egg Farmers of New Brunswick is excited to celebrate New Meadow Farm’s leadership in reducing their carbon footprint as the first New Brunswick egg farmer to install a NOREASTER commercial solar farm. This initiative supports our sector’s longstanding work in the area of environmental sustainability and is another step towards Egg Farmers of Canada’s commitment to achieve net-zero greenhouse gas emissions by 2050.
— Egg Farmers of New Brunswick
